What's Happening?
Micro-communities are emerging as a significant trend in lifestyle marketing, offering brands a way to engage deeply with specific groups of consumers. These small, purpose-driven groups are formed around shared interests, roles, or challenges, allowing for more personalized interactions and direct feedback. Brands are leveraging micro-communities to gather meaningful insights, foster stronger advocacy, and enhance customer retention. The focus on smaller, more intentional spaces is proving effective in building loyalty and creating authentic engagement, as members feel valued and connected to the brand.
Why It's Important?
The rise of micro-communities reflects a shift in consumer preferences towards personalization and authenticity. In an era where digital noise is prevalent, these communities offer brands a way to cut through the clutter and engage with consumers on a deeper level. By fostering a sense of belonging and mutual support, micro-communities enhance brand loyalty and advocacy, which are crucial for long-term success. Brands that successfully integrate micro-communities into their marketing strategies can benefit from faster feedback loops, increased agility, and stronger customer relationships.
What's Next?
Brands are expected to continue exploring the potential of micro-communities, integrating them into broader marketing strategies to enhance engagement and drive growth. As these communities evolve, brands may experiment with hybrid models that combine online and offline interactions, further strengthening the sense of community and connection among members. The focus will likely remain on creating authentic, meaningful experiences that resonate with consumers and foster long-term loyalty.
